DWB Welcomes: Sarayu Adeni

Join us for our fourth meeting of the semester! DWB at UT Austin will be welcoming Sarayu Adeni, the global health program coordinator at the Department of Population Health of Dell Medical School. Adeni is Dell Med’s liaison to the UT International Office and facilitates global health activities involving faculty, residents, students and partners at UT Austin and in Kenya and Mexico.

Adeni served as a Peace Corps Volunteer in the Dominican Republic from 2010-2012, building PEPFAR-funded teen health promotion groups and supporting women’s and girls’ involvement in community development projects. In her free time, she currently supports refugee girls resettled in Austin via the nonprofit GirlForward. Adeni earned her Master of Public Administration in Development Practice from Columbia University’s School of International and Public Affairs. Adeni has a Bachelor’s degree in journalism and a Bridging Disciplines Certificate in international studies from The University of Texas at Austin, and also completed a semester of study and independent research in Chile with the School for International Training.
